147 lines
7.8 KiB
Plaintext
147 lines
7.8 KiB
Plaintext
<%@ Control Language="C#" AutoEventWireup="true" CodeBehind="mod_confProd.ascx.cs" Inherits="MoonProTablet.WebUserControls.mod_confProd" %>
|
|
|
|
<script type="text/javascript">
|
|
function hideConfirmButton() {
|
|
document.getElementById('<%= lbtSalva.ClientID %>').hidden = true;
|
|
}
|
|
function showConfirmButton() {
|
|
document.getElementById('<%= lbtSalva.ClientID %>').hidden = false;
|
|
}
|
|
</script>
|
|
|
|
<div class="card bg-secondary">
|
|
<div class="card-header p-0">
|
|
<div class="row">
|
|
<div class="col-12">
|
|
<asp:Label runat="server" ID="lblConfProd" CssClass="btn btn-secondary btn-lg w-100 disabled">
|
|
<i class="fa fa-check"></i> MOSTRA Conferma
|
|
</asp:Label>
|
|
<asp:Label runat="server" ID="lblMancaODL" Visible="false" ForeColor="Red">MANCA ODL: conferma NON permessa</asp:Label>
|
|
<asp:LinkButton runat="server" ID="lbtShowConfProd" OnClick="lbtShowConfProd_Click" CssClass="btn btn-success btn-lg w-100">
|
|
<i class="fa fa-check"></i>
|
|
<asp:Label runat="server" ID="lblShowConfProd" />
|
|
</asp:LinkButton>
|
|
</div>
|
|
<div class="col-12" runat="server" id="divSelMacc">
|
|
<asp:DropDownList runat="server" ID="ddlSubMacc" DataSourceID="ods" CssClass="form-control" DataTextField="CodMaccArticolo" DataValueField="IdxMacchina" AutoPostBack="True" OnSelectedIndexChanged="ddlSubMacc_SelectedIndexChanged" OnDataBound="ddlSubMacc_DataBound"></asp:DropDownList>
|
|
<asp:ObjectDataSource runat="server" ID="ods" OldValuesParameterFormatString="original_{0}" SelectMethod="getMulti" TypeName="MapoDb.DS_applicazioneTableAdapters.MSFDTableAdapter" FilterExpression="idxMacchina LIKE '%#%'">
|
|
<SelectParameters>
|
|
<asp:SessionParameter DefaultValue="0" Name="IdxMacchina" SessionField="IdxMacchina" Type="String" />
|
|
</SelectParameters>
|
|
</asp:ObjectDataSource>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="card-body p-0 text-light">
|
|
<div class="row textCondens text-end bg-dark m-1 p-1" runat="server" id="divInnovazioni" onloadeddata="showConfirmButton()">
|
|
<div class="col-6 py-1 text-start text-uppercase">
|
|
<b>Dati Incrementali</b>
|
|
</div>
|
|
<div class="col-6 text-end">
|
|
<sub>ultima conferma -->
|
|
<asp:Label runat="server" ID="lblDtRec"></asp:Label></sub>
|
|
</div>
|
|
<div class="col-6 col-sm-3 pr-1 align-self-end fw-bold">
|
|
<asp:Label runat="server" ID="lblNumPezzi" CssClass="mb-0" AssociatedControlID="txtNumPezzi" Text="Pz Prodotti CONFERMATI" />
|
|
<asp:TextBox runat="server" ID="txtNumPezzi" Font-Size="XX-Large" TextMode="Number" CssClass="form-control text-end alert alert-warning py-0 mb-0" Enabled="true" AutoPostBack="True" OnTextChanged="txtNumPezzi_TextChanged" onfocus="hideConfirmButton()" onblur="showConfirmButton()" />
|
|
</div>
|
|
<div class="col-6 col-sm-3 px-1 align-self-end fw-bold">
|
|
<div class="px-2">
|
|
<asp:Label runat="server" ID="lblPzSca2Rec" CssClass="text-danger" Text="Pz Scarto" />
|
|
+
|
|
<asp:Label runat="server" ID="lblPzBuo2Rec" CssClass="text-success" Text="Pz Buoni" />
|
|
</div>
|
|
<div class="px-2" style="font-size: 2em;">
|
|
<asp:Label runat="server" ID="lblPz2RecScarto" CssClass="text-danger py-0">[B2]</asp:Label>
|
|
+
|
|
<asp:Label runat="server" ID="lblPz2RecBuoni" CssClass="text-success py-0">[C2]</asp:Label>
|
|
</div>
|
|
</div>
|
|
<div class="col-6 col-sm-3 pr-1 align-self-end fw-bold">
|
|
<asp:Label runat="server" ID="lblNumLasciati" CssClass="mb-0" AssociatedControlID="txtNumPezzi" Text="Pz Prodotti LASCIATI" />
|
|
<asp:TextBox runat="server" ID="txtNumLasciati" Font-Size="XX-Large" TextMode="Number" CssClass="form-control text-end alert alert-secondary py-0 mb-0" Enabled="true" AutoPostBack="True" OnTextChanged="txtNumLasciati_TextChanged" onfocus="hideConfirmButton()" onblur="showConfirmButton()" />
|
|
<asp:Label runat="server" ID="lblEmptyNumLasciati" CssClass="btn btn-dark text-light btn-lg w-100" Visible="false"> </asp:Label>
|
|
</div>
|
|
<div class="col-6 col-sm-3 pl-1 align-self-end fw-bold">
|
|
<asp:LinkButton runat="server" ID="lbtSalva" CssClass="btn btn-success text-light btn-lg w-100" OnClick="lbtSalva_Click"><i class="fa fa-floppy-o"></i> CONFERMA</asp:LinkButton>
|
|
<asp:Label runat="server" ID="lblUpdating" CssClass="btn btn-dark text-light btn-lg w-100" Visible="false"><i class="fa fa-circle-o-notch fa-spin"></i> USER INPUT</asp:Label>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="row textCondens">
|
|
<div class="col-12">
|
|
<asp:UpdateProgress ID="updtRicerca" runat="server" DisplayAfter="10" DynamicLayout="true">
|
|
<ProgressTemplate>
|
|
<div id="progress_back">
|
|
</div>
|
|
<div id="progress_top" class="text-center text-warning align-middle">
|
|
<i class="fa fa-spinner fa-pulse"></i>
|
|
<b>ELABORAZIONE IN CORSO</b>
|
|
<i class="fa fa-spinner fa-pulse"></i>
|
|
<div class="progress">
|
|
<div class="progress-bar progress-bar-striped bg-success progress-bar-animated" role="progressbar" aria-valuenow="75" aria-valuemin="0" aria-valuemax="100" style="width: 75%"></div>
|
|
</div>
|
|
</div>
|
|
</ProgressTemplate>
|
|
</asp:UpdateProgress>
|
|
</div>
|
|
</div>
|
|
<div class="row textCondens">
|
|
<div class="col-6 py-1 text-start text-uppercase">
|
|
<b>Dati Globali ODL</b>
|
|
</div>
|
|
<div class="col-6 text-end" id="divPeriodo">
|
|
<sub>Periodo ODL calcolato:
|
|
<asp:Label runat="server" ID="lblInizio">[dtInizio]</asp:Label>
|
|
-
|
|
<asp:Label runat="server" ID="lblFine">[dtFine]</asp:Label></sub>
|
|
</div>
|
|
<div class="col-6 col-sm-3 pr-1 py-0 text-end">
|
|
<div class="alert alert-warning py-1">
|
|
<div class="text-truncate">
|
|
[A] NUOVI Pz.Prod
|
|
</div>
|
|
<div style="font-size: 2em; font-weight: bold;" class="my-0">
|
|
<asp:Label runat="server" ID="lblPz2RecTot">[A]</asp:Label>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="col-6 col-sm-3 pl-1 px-sm-1 py-0 text-end">
|
|
<div class="alert alert-info py-1">
|
|
<div class="text-truncate">
|
|
Pz Prodotti TOT [A+B+C]
|
|
</div>
|
|
<div style="font-size: 2em; font-weight: bold;" class="my-0">
|
|
<asp:Label runat="server" ID="lblPzTotODL">[A+B+C]</asp:Label>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="col-6 col-sm-3 pr-1 px-sm-1 py-0 text-end">
|
|
<div class="alert alert-danger py-1">
|
|
<div class="text-truncate">
|
|
[B] Scarti VERS.
|
|
</div>
|
|
<div style="font-size: 2em; font-weight: bold;" class="my-0">
|
|
<asp:Label runat="server" ID="lblPzConfScarto">[B]</asp:Label>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="col-6 col-sm-3 pl-1 py-0 text-end">
|
|
<div class="alert alert-success py-1">
|
|
<div class="text-truncate">
|
|
[C] Pz Buoni VERS.
|
|
</div>
|
|
<div style="font-size: 2em; font-weight: bold;" class="my-0">
|
|
<asp:Label runat="server" ID="lblPzConfBuoni">[C]</asp:Label>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
<div class="row my-2">
|
|
<div class="col-12">
|
|
<asp:Label runat="server" ID="lblOut" ForeColor="Red" />
|
|
</div>
|
|
</div>
|
|
<asp:HiddenField runat="server" ID="hfDtReqUpdate" />
|